Finding the right natural product can make a world of difference for your health and lifestyle. Start by understanding your needs—whether you're looking for skincare, supplements, or eco-friendly household items. Check labels carefully to ensure ingredients are truly natural and free from harmful chemicals. Research trusted brands with sustainable practices and positive reviews. Remember, everyone’s body and environment are unique, so what works for one person might not work for another. Take your time to test and find what fits your goals and values.     Bachelor of Science in Natural Resources – Wood Products Major

    Bachelor of Science in Natural Resources – Wood Products Major

    If you are interested in engineering and sustainable design and production, and enjoy innovation and problem solving, the Wood Products major is ideal for you. Increasingly, the world is demanding sustainable and innovative products, and UBC is considered a world leader in advancing the science of wood product potential.

    Understanding the merits of a sustainable product for the use in building, manufacturing, and engineering while exploring innovative product potentials for wood will equip you to meet demands from the world of tomorrow. Throughout the program, students have access to Canada’s national centre of excellence for wood products at our extensive facilities housed in our Centre for Advanced Wood Processing.

    Students also have the benefit of pursuing a minor in Commerce that explores science, engineering, and business with a cohort of like-minded peers. Students are also encouraged to consider the Co-op program where doors are opened to diverse and exciting career opportunities, and students are able to connect with leaders in the sector.

    This program is the proud winner of the Yves Landry Foundation Award for the Most Innovative Manufacturing Technology Program at the University Level, and the Alfred Scow Award for Outstanding Contributions to the Student Experience and Learning Environment at the University of British Columbia.
